Patient Care Coordinator/Authorization Specialist

Tucson Orthopedic Institute
11.2025 - 04.2026
  • Confirmed patient insurance coverage, benefits and eligibility prior to scheduled services
  • Verify patient demographics, insurance plan details and co-pay, co-insurance and out of pocket amounts
  • Conduct outbound calls to Insurance Companies, Patients and Prescriber offices to verify referral/order
  • Track patient visits for specialty, review patients EMR on daily basis to confirm approvals prior to check in
  • Create and submit authorization requests to insurance carriers, following deadlines to avoid denials and track authorizations to confirm status prior to appointments
  • Communicate with healthcare providers, insurance companies, and patients to gather and confirm required information
  • Skilled at navigating complex issues to secure necessary authorizations.
  • Responded to a high number of patients and provider inquiries per month regarding the status of authorization requests, providing clear and accurate information.
  • Coordinated Authorization requests once submitted and structured follow-up cycles so pending requests are checked, escalated, and documented on time
  • Managed multiple desktop screens and applications including emails, teams and in person patient care when needed

MEDICAL ASSISTANT

Banner Health (OBGYN)
08.2021 - 12.2021
  • Checked in patients, roomed patients, took vitals, and prepped for procedures.
  • Performed blood draws, called to confirm appointments, and assisted providers with procedures.
  • Conducted urinalysis, intramuscular injections, and stocked medical rooms.
  • Obtained prior authorization on medications, NIPT testing, and HbA1c testing.
  • Drew medications from vials.
  • Assisted healthcare providers with patient examinations and procedures, ensuring comfort and compliance.
  • Managed patient records using electronic health record systems to maintain accuracy and confidentiality.
  • Educated patients on treatment plans and medication instructions to enhance understanding and adherence.
  • Obtained client medical history, medication information, symptoms, and allergies.
  • Directed patients to exam rooms, fielded questions, and prepared for physician examinations.
